In a somewhat unexpected move, popular Halo 2-based machinima Red vs. Blue is making its way onto Xbox Live Marketplace. As of today, the first five episodes of the long-running series are available for download at 80 points ($1) each. There is no bundle option -- each episode must be purchased individually (hear that, RedOctane?). The episodes range in size from about 75 to 140 MB.
A dollar isn't much, but the RvB website offers a chunk of free episodes in a rotating schedules, so you could just wait to get these free. Granted, with the 70+ episodes they've created, you could be waiting a while. There's also the fact that you can get nineteen episodes (plus special features) in a $20 DVD sets from Rooster Teeth's store, and a couple other places let you catch Red vs. Blue online for free.
